LEADERSHIP BRIEFING — Board Review

Topic: Launch plan for Brightmere

Quick read before Thursday: Brightmere is tracking to a spring launch. Beta feedback from the Calverton pilot group has been strong — retention well above our internal bar. Pricing lands at two tiers; channel partners briefed under NDA. Marketing spend is front-loaded into the first six weeks. One open risk: fulfilment capacity at the Renholt site. The confidential note below covers how this launch fits the wider roadmap.

board note of kagep-yahig: Only 9 of the 120 pilot accounts renewed Quenix, so a churn review is set for April 1.

// Log sampling for the Pebbleway ingest service.
// This service emits ~40k lines/min at peak; unsampled, it drowns
// Huskline and blows the retention budget. Errors are never sampled.
// Info and debug are rate-limited per logger key, with a burst
// allowance for startup. Review changes against the cost dashboard.
// Effective sampling constants follow.

constants for bawif-kawif:
QUOTAS = {
    "ulaael": 5,
    "holael": 10,
}

Root causes: vendor integration slippage at the Varnholt site and unplanned rework of the ledger module. Mitigations underway: scope freeze, weekly escalation calls chaired by Delia Marchbank, and reassignment of two engineers from the Orvale team. Budget impact is contained for now; contingency draw stands at 40 percent. No further slippage is acceptable before the Q3 checkpoint. Decisions required today: approve the revised milestone plan and staffing shift. The following note is for this group only.

internal memo for yahag-hahig: Belwynix Group plans to lower the Silir list price by 62 percent in May.